Skip to content

Commit fa35dbf

Browse files
committed
[WIP] Save test draft from experiments while pairing for #241.
1 parent 09237a6 commit fa35dbf

File tree

2 files changed

+7
-1
lines changed

2 files changed

+7
-1
lines changed

metaschema-cli/src/main/java/gov/nist/secauto/metaschema/cli/commands/QueryCommand.java

+1-1
Original file line numberDiff line numberDiff line change
@@ -70,7 +70,7 @@ public class QueryCommand
7070
Option.builder("i")
7171
.hasArg()
7272
.argName("FILE")
73-
.required()
73+
//.required()
7474
.desc("metaschema content instance resource")
7575
.build());
7676
@NonNull

metaschema-cli/src/test/java/gov/nist/secauto/metaschema/cli/CLITest.java

+6
Original file line numberDiff line numberDiff line change
@@ -68,6 +68,12 @@ void testMetaschemaGenerateSchema() {
6868
evaluateResult(CLI.runCli(args), ExitCode.OK);
6969
}
7070

71+
@Test
72+
void testExecuteCommandQueryOnly() {
73+
String[] args = {"query", "-m", "module.xml", "-i", "content-instance.xml", "\"2 + 2\""};
74+
evaluateResult(CLI.runCli(args), ExitCode.OK);
75+
}
76+
7177
void evaluateResult(@NonNull ExitStatus status, @NonNull ExitCode expectedCode) {
7278
status.generateMessage(true);
7379
assertAll(

0 commit comments

Comments
 (0)